Feel relaxed in life, secure in yourself, and confident in tomorrow.

Online therapy for anxiety, OCD, and eating disorders for teens and adults in Philadelphia and beyond

GET STARTED

Life isn’t unfolding the way you expected.

You imagined things would feel manageable—maybe even satisfying—but instead you feel weighed down by anxiety and pressure. Getting yourself to school or work can feel daunting, your to-do list never seems to shrink, and your mind is constantly calculating what might go wrong if you fall behind or make a mistake. Sleep doesn’t feel restorative, either because your thoughts won’t slow down or because worry takes over at night, and the urge to avoid everything—just for a day—can feel incredibly strong. You might notice patterns that are hard to escape: perfectionism that makes starting or finishing tasks exhausting, intrusive thoughts or fears that demand your attention, rigid rules around food, routines, or safety that promise relief but only tighten their grip.

And beneath it all is a painful question: Why does this feel so hard when I’m trying so hard already?

Your life may appear put-together from the outside—shaped by responsibility, high expectations, and a strong drive to do things “right.”

Yet internally, you notice:

  • a constant sense of pressure as you try to balance school or work, family responsibilities, and relationships, with little space to rest or reset

  • ongoing responsibilities from teachers, supervisors, parents, or family members, paired with a feeling that it’s up to you to keep things from falling apart

  • persistent self-monitoring—how you perform, how you’re perceived, whether you’re doing enough—that follows you from public settings into private moments

  • mental fatigue from continual overthinking and self-correction, making it hard to focus in class, at work, or fully engage with people you care about

  • a quiet fear that your efforts and achievements are never enough to guarantee security, approval, or belonging

  • feeling stuck when facing important life decisions, delaying action not because you don’t care, but because the cost of choosing “wrong” feels too high

I believe that everyone can learn, grow, and feel better with the right support.

As a licensed psychologist with years of experience, I have the knowledge, skill, and expertise to help you manage stress, make effective choices, and focus on what truly matters. I work with teens and adults navigating anxiety, perfectionism, OCD, phobias, and eating disorders, and I understand how overwhelming life can feel when your mind is constantly on high alert.

I pair genuine care with research-backed, evidence-based approaches to create a safe and comfortable space where you can slow down, feel understood, and begin to loosen patterns that no longer serve you. Therapy is not about fixing you—it’s about finding you, and helping you build flexibility, self-trust, and resilience so you can move forward with greater ease.

My clients leave therapy with increased clarity, confidence, and a sense of empowerment, equipped to take meaningful next steps in their education, careers, relationships, and personal lives.

Therapy that goes wherever you go.

I offer convenient online therapy to people located in Philadelphia and across the United States, including these 42 states. All you need is a private space, a smart phone or laptop, and a strong internet connection. 

No traveling to an office.  No sitting in a waiting room.  And no stopping sessions or finding a new therapist when you’re out of state.  Just expert support wherever you are.

Anxiety & Perfectionism

Learn the tools to relax and adapt from a mental health specialist who understands the brain, mind, and heart.

Learn More

OCD & Phobias

Stop harmful behaviors and gain freedom from fear with the guidance of a therapist who will support your goals.

Learn More

Eating Disorders & Body Image

Find peace with food and your body through the help of an expert who knows the ins and outs of disordered eating.

Learn More

Ready to get started? I make it simple.

1

Reach out.

Click the button below to fill out the Get Started form. It’s that easy!

2

Get connected.

I’ll contact you to schedule a free 15-minute phone consultation.  I’ll answer any questions you have, so you can feel confident that I’m the right therapist for you.

3

Be supported.

We’ll schedule our first appointment, and I’ll take the time to get to know you.  Together, we’ll set goals and then work toward them, helping you whether you’re at home or on the road.

GET STARTED

Let’s make it a better today, and the start of a good tomorrow.